In continuation of our program aimed at the discovery and development of natural products-based insecticidal agents, a series of novel phenazine derivatives of 4β-acyloxypodophyllotoxin modified in the E-ring were synthesized, and preliminarily evaluated for their insecticidal activity against the pre-third-instar larvae of Mythimna separata Walker in vivo. Among all the derivatives, compounds 7b, 7g, 7h and 7j exhibited more pronounced insecticidal activity than or comparable to toosendanin. Especially compounds 7h and 7j displayed the best promising insecticidal activity. Meanwhile, the relationships between their structures and the insecticidal activity were also described.
